# Runbook: Hunting leaked file descriptors in Quillgate

When the `fd_open` gauge climbs steadily between deploys, suspect a leak rather than load. First confirm on a single pod: exec in and count entries under `/proc/1/fd`, noting how many are sockets in CLOSE_WAIT versus regular files. Capture two snapshots ten minutes apart before restarting anything — we need the delta for the postmortem. Reproduce locally with the Marbury load harness, which requires the service running with the following configuration values.

settings of yagep-bajog:
[istdor]
port = 4000
region = south-2
host = istdor.qorvelcorp.internal
timeout_ms = 5000
retries = 5

**Leadership Review Briefing — Training Budget, Next Year**

For the sales leads at Merriden Supply Co. We propose a modest uplift in the training allocation, weighted toward negotiation skills and the new Castellan quoting platform. Each regional team receives a ring-fenced sum; unspent amounts return centrally at year end. Attendance will be tracked and reported quarterly. This supports the account-growth targets already circulated. The confidential rationale follows immediately below this briefing.

board note of kagep-yahig: Only 9 of the 120 pilot accounts renewed Quenix, so a churn review is set for April 1.

Memo — Welcome aboard, and the Norcliffe push

Quick brief before your first week: we're moving ahead with the expansion into the Norcliffe region. Two retail sites are under negotiation and a small distribution point near Tarnmouth is nearly signed. Local hiring starts next month; Mara Wexley is running logistics until you're settled. Budget is approved but tight, so expect some horse-trading with finance. Keep this quiet outside the leadership circle for now. The full rationale is in the confidential note below.

confidential, kagup-bafog: Fraaxax Group is in early talks to buy Soroxox Group for about $343.8 million. The Olidor launch date is June 14, and nothing goes to the press before then. Legal wants the Aldmirek Logistics term sheet signed before July 23.

Step 4: Query planner regression gate. The Quillbase 3.9 planner regressed on correlated subqueries; 3.9.2 carries the fix. Do not promote until the plan-diff job reports zero regressions against the Ravenmoor workload snapshot. Pin the planner feature flag off in staging, run the gate, then re-enable. Once the gate is green, sign the promotion manifest. Verification requires the deploy key below.

signing key of kahog-kadup = bky13_6wLyxnPsJob4P